Preferred Label : Extensor Hallucis Brevis Muscle;

NCIt definition : A muscle on the dorsal side of the foot that helps to extend the big toe. It originates on the superior surface of the anterior calcaneus and inserts into the dorsal surface of the base of the proximal phalanx of the big toe. It is innervated by the deep fibular nerve and supplied by the dorsalis pedis artery.;

Alternative definition : CDISC: A muscle in the foot, in general extending from the superior surface of the anterior calcaneus to the dorsal surface of the base of the proximal phalanx of the big toe; primary function is to extend the big toe.;
